An upset loss to South Florida was enough to knock the Florida Gators out of the AP Top 25 heading into Week 3.
Hopes were high for the Orange and Blue entering the season, but two weeks of inconsistent offense have many doubting Billy Napier’s squad, which faces the toughest schedule in the nation. Florida’s Week 2 No. 13 ranking could be its peak if things don’t go well against the eight remaining ranked teams on the schedule.

All hope is not lost, however. Florida is the unofficial No. 29 team in the country with 70 poll points, according to the AP Top 25. A win over No. 3 LSU next week could easily get Florida back into the conversation.
SEC schools in the Week 2 AP Top 25
The Southeastern Conference boasts 11 total teams in the top 25, even with Florida falling out of favor. The third-ranked LSU Tigers lead the way, followed by the sixth-ranked Georgia Bulldogs, the seventh-ranked Texas Longhorns, and the 11th-ranked South Carolina Gamecocks.
Next up are the Oklahoma Sooners at No. 13. The Tennessee Volunteers were the big climbers this week, jumping seven spots to No. 15. The Texas A&M Aggies and the Ole Miss Rebels own the Nos. 16 and 17 spots, respectively. The Alabama Crimson Tide are No. 19, and Auburn and Missouri are the two newcomers at Nos. 24 and 25, respectively.

In addition to Florida, Mississippi State (52) and Vanderbilt (1) earned votes.
